An Ordinance to provide for the collection and disposal of waste and to make consequential amendments to the Public Health and Urban Services Ordinance.

[

]

Enacted by the Governor of Hong Kong, with the advice and consent of the Legislative Council thereof.

PART I

PRELIMINARY

1. (1) This Ordinance may be cited as the Waste Disposal Ordin- Short title and ance 1980.

(2) This Ordinance shall come into operation on a day to be appointed by the Governor by notice in the Gazette, and notices under this section may appoint different dates for different provisions of this Ordinance.

2. (1) In this Ordinance, unless the context otherwise requires—

"animal waste" means the manure of any animal and also means any part of any dead animal not fit for, or not intended for, human con- sumption;

"collection authority" means-

(a) in respect of the urban areas, the Urban Council;

(b) in respect of the New Territories (excluding New Kowloon), the Director of Urban Services and the Director of Agriculture and Fisheries;

"household waste" means waste produced by a household, and of a kind

that is ordinarily produced by a dwelling when occupied as such;

"street waste" means dust, dirt, rubbish, mud, road scapings or filth, but

does not include human excretal matter;

"trade waste" means waste from any trade, manufacture or business, or any waste building or civil engineering materials, but does not include animal waste;

"waste" means any substance or article which is abandoned;

"waste collection licence" means a licence under section 10;
